The episode is described as: "The family's robot is seemingly replaced when Will repairs a robotoid from an advanced civilization - until the new machine wreaks havoc by trying to take over the ship." In the episode, the Lost in Space robot says: "It is more than a is a robotoid." The robot goes on to explain that as a robot, it is constrained by its programming, whereas the robotoid has the capability of making a choice.
